Transaction 9646802047256178fa73de1a69ed3d56de40775cfb7ae40aa96c4c8066f36b95
1 Input
1 Output
-
9646802047256178fa73de1a69ed3d56de40775cfb7ae40aa96c4c8066f36b95:0
- value
- 297744
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1181f73f6176028b6f51f98c6fdbe7a516e01fdf OP_EQUALVERIFY OP_CHECKSIG
- address
- 12baBSkW2CfoVK4mZnEbvmPEybNTPRYQVp